Committee on Standard Jury Instructions in Contract and Business Cases now accepting applications

The Florida Supreme Court Committee on Standard Jury Instructions in Contract and Business Cases is seeking applicants for vacancies. Judges and attorneys interested in applying may obtain an application by clicking here. Completed applications should be submitted by e-mail to Michael Hodges, Bar Staff Liaison, The Florida Bar rules@floridabar.org, no later than March 31, 2024.

Employee accuses American Airlines of sexual harassment

An employee is accusing American Airlines of sexual harassment. Alissa Gilman filed her lawsuit in federal court alleging she suffered sexual harassment and national origin-based discrimination at her workplace. Florida lawmakers proposing bills to mandate disclosure of third-party litigation funding

A Florida measure is advancing in the state Legislature that would require the disclosure of third-party litigation funding agreements in civil lawsuits, limit what investors could recover through damages awards and boost transparency of foreign financial interests.
